Eric has been reported to have a mild form of dyslexia, a common learning difficulty that affects the ability to read and process language. Dyslexia is often characterized by difficulties with accurate and/or fluent word recognition and by poor spelling and decoding abilities.
It's important to note that dyslexia is not related to intelligence; rather, it's a specific neurological condition. Children with dyslexia can excel in many areas, often showcasing strengths in creativity, problem-solving, and critical thinking. What is dyslexia?
Dyslexia is a common learning difficulty that affects the ability to read and process language. It is characterized by difficulties with word recognition, spelling, and decoding abilities, but it is not related to intelligence.
How is dyslexia diagnosed?
Dyslexia is diagnosed through assessments by psychologists, educators, and other specialists. These assessments evaluate the child's reading and language processing abilities to determine the presence of dyslexia.
What support is available for children with dyslexia?
Support for children with dyslexia includes specialized educational programs, therapeutic interventions, and resources that cater to their unique learning needs. Early diagnosis and intervention are key to effective support.
How can parents support a child with dyslexia?
Parents can support a child with dyslexia by creating a supportive and understanding environment, seeking professional guidance, and advocating for their child's needs. Encouraging participation in activities that align with their interests and strengths is also beneficial.
What role does advocacy play in supporting children with learning disabilities?
Advocacy plays a crucial role in raising awareness, dispelling myths, and encouraging support for children with learning disabilities. It can drive positive change and lead to improved support systems and resources.
How can educators support students with dyslexia?
Educators can support students with dyslexia by providing personalized learning experiences, using multisensory teaching techniques, and fostering an inclusive classroom environment that recognizes and supports diverse learning needs.
